1. About Orakai Insadong Suites

Let’s take a quick look at some basic info on Orakai Insadong Suites’.

Source: Official Website of the Hotel

On a block with eateries, this unpretentious apartment hotel is a 7-minute walk from the nearest subway stop, a 16-minute subway ride from the 14th-century Gyeongbokgung palace, and 18 minutes by subway from N Seoul Tower.

Featuring kitchens, and living rooms with sofas, the casual 1- to 4-bedroom apartments have flat-screen TVs and washer/dryers. High-speed Internet access is available.

Amenities include a gym, and a heated indoor pool with a kids’ section, as well as a sauna, a steam room, and a playroom. Breakfast is served in an informal dining area (fee).

2.1. Review 1 : “Orakai Insadong Suites offers a spacious and comfortable stay in the heart of Seoul at a reasonable price, making it a perfect choice for family trips!”

Summary of the Blog Post

Recently, I stayed at Orakai Insadong Suites for three nights with my family. When choosing accommodation, I considered locations within walking distance for my child, reasonable pricing, and a residence-type setup with separate rooms for living and sleeping. Orakai Suites met all these criteria perfectly. Stepping out of the hotel, Insa-dong is to the left, while Ikseon-dong and Jongno are just a 5-minute walk away.

Check-in starts at 4 PM, and check-out is at 11 AM, giving us plenty of time. Parking is available until noon on the check-out day. We were upgraded to a room on the 18th floor, and the warm heater greeted us as we entered. The room was so warm that we didn’t need to turn on the heater the next day.

One of the highlights was the spacious living area. After putting our child to bed, we could quietly watch TV and enjoy a drink, which was essential for us. The room cost less than 150,000 won, providing ample space that exceeded our expectations.

On the second floor, there is a heated swimming pool, and the kitchen is equipped with a drying rack and washing machine, making it convenient for post-swim use. The suite has a gas stove, microwave, rice cooker, and toaster, but we opted for delivery food instead of using the kitchen.

The bedroom features a large double bed and a small TV, spacious enough for three people to sleep comfortably. However, there was some dust on the bedding, and the pillows were too soft, which made them uncomfortable. The hotel didn’t feel extremely clean, but it was adequately tidy.

Our room had a view of Lotte Tower to the right and Gyeongbokgung Palace to the left, with Ikseon-dong and Jongno visible below. There is also a view of Namsan Tower, making the location truly excellent.

The bathroom was spacious, equipped with both a bathtub and a shower. The amenities provided included soap, shampoo, and body wash, so we had to bring our own toothbrushes and toothpaste (there’s a 7-Eleven right in front of the hotel for convenience). A toddler step stool was available, and the toilet had a bidet, which was a nice touch.

Overall, we had a very quiet and restful stay. While the cleanliness could have been improved, it’s hard to find such spacious accommodations at a reasonable price in the heart of Seoul. If there are other places like this, I would love to know!

2.2. Review 2 : “Orakai Insadong Suites is a spacious and comfortable residence hotel, perfect for family trips!”

Summary of the Blog Post

Recently, I stayed at Orakai Insadong Suites for 2 nights and 3 days with my family. This trip was planned after my mother expressed a desire to visit Seoul again, and this time my father and younger sibling joined us, making it essential to find accommodations suitable for four adults. After considering various options, I chose this residence hotel located in Insa-dong, which is conveniently close to major tourist attractions like Gyeongbokgung, Gwanghwamun, Cheonggyecheon, Myeongdong, and Namsan.

Check-in starts at 4 PM, but we arrived 30 minutes early and were able to receive our keys right away. The hotel lobby featured traditional Korean decor with comfortable seating areas, creating a welcoming atmosphere. We were assigned to room 1505 on the 15th floor, a two-bedroom suite. As soon as we entered, we were greeted by a spacious living area with enough room to open our luggage comfortably.

The living area was perfect for spending time together as a family, and to the right, there were two bedrooms: a smaller room with two single beds and a larger room with a queen-sized bed and an attached bathroom. The bathroom included a bathtub, sink, bidet, and shower, making it very convenient to use. Basic amenities such as soap, shampoo, body wash, and body lotion were provided, but we needed to bring our own toothbrushes and toothpaste.

The kitchen was well-equipped with a washing machine, refrigerator, oven, microwave, rice cooker, toaster, and all necessary utensils, making it easy to clean up after meals. On the second day, we enjoyed a relaxed meal at the dining table.

Breakfast was served on the 2nd floor, with hours from 7 AM to 9:30 AM on weekdays and from 7:30 AM to 10 AM on weekends and holidays. The cost was 15,000 won per person, and there was a good variety of dishes offered. While additional charges applied for made-to-order items like omelets and fried eggs, the buffet selection was satisfying, especially the soup and yogurt.

Overall, the atmosphere of the accommodations was comfortable and quiet, with excellent soundproofing that ensured we hardly noticed any noise. The spacious layout allowed our family of four to stay together comfortably. With various room types available, I would highly recommend Orakai Insadong Suites for anyone planning a family trip to Seoul. The combination of spacious accommodations, convenient amenities, and a great location near key attractions makes it an ideal choice for families. Despite some minor cleanliness concerns, the overall experience was very satisfying, and I would definitely consider returning for another stay.

2.3. Review 3 : “Orakai Insadong Suites offers a perfect long-term stay with its convenient location and excellent facilities for business travelers and families alike!”

Summary of the Blog Post

I would like to share my experience of staying at Orakai Insadong Suites, located in Insa-dong, Jongno-gu, Seoul, for a month. This hotel boasts an optimal location close to major attractions such as Myeongdong, Namsan Tower, and Gyeongbokgung Palace, and it is surrounded by various traditional markets and restaurants, making it very convenient for travelers. As a four-star business hotel, it offers excellent value for money and is suitable for family travelers as well.

Check-in is available from 4 PM, and while parking is possible, pets are not allowed. I decided to return this year because I had a pleasant experience staying in a three-bedroom suite last year. The hotel lobby features a business center and meeting rooms, making it suitable for business visitors. Various office services are available, and you can inquire at the front desk if needed.

On the second floor, there is a free indoor heated swimming pool, sauna, fitness center, and a children’s playroom, providing many facilities suitable for families. Breakfast is priced at 18,000 won per person, with operating hours from 7 AM to 9:30 AM on weekdays and from 7:30 AM to 10 AM on weekends and holidays.

The two-bedroom suite is a residence-style accommodation with a living room that includes a dining area and kitchen, two bedrooms, and two bathrooms. There is a separate shoe cabinet and laundry room, which adds to its practicality. Upon entering the room, I was impressed by the luxurious decor and the pleasant environment provided by the central heating and cooling system. The dining area and kitchen are equipped with a table for four and various cooking utensils, making it very convenient for long stays.

Additionally, there is a washing machine, iron, and ironing board available for convenience. Long-term guests enjoy special benefits, including daily breakfast and free access to all facilities, as well as discounts at the coffee shop and business center.

The master bedroom features a queen-sized bed and a spacious bathroom with a bathtub, making it suitable for couples. Basic amenities are provided in the shower, and the overall cleanliness was well-maintained. The natural light coming through multiple windows allowed us to enjoy various views during the day and night, with both city views and Namsan views available.

In conclusion, Orakai Insadong Suites is an ideal accommodation for both family and business travelers. With its convenient location and excellent facilities, I would personally recommend it. It offers great value for money, and I often recommend this hotel to my friends.
